Occupational Therapist, Owner
Nicola Josephs
BScKin, MScOT
Nicola holds a BSc in Kinesiology from the University of Calgary and an MSc in Occupational Therapy from the University of Alberta. Since graduating in 2021, she has lived across BC and AB, working with people with a variety of diagnoses and ages, from 1 to 101 years old! She has found her passion in pediatrics and feels fortunate to establish her practice in the beautiful East Kootenays - a place she has called home for the last two years. Nicola believes that the best therapy comes from incorporating the child's interests into sessions to make OT meaningful and fun for all! She is committed to fully understanding each child's unique neuro and sensory differences to provide the highest quality service. In her spare time, Nicola enjoys spending time with her wobbly cat, Turtle, and exploring the local trails on foot, bike, and skis!

Occupational Therapist
Sarah Bouvier
BKin, MScOT
Sarah earned her Bachelor’s degree in Kinesiology from Mount Royal University, followed by a Master’s degree in Occupational Therapy from the University of Alberta. Sarah has always been passionate about working with kids and has supported children aged 3 months to 16 years in a wide range of clinical contexts.
She has worked with children diagnosed with a broad spectrum of conditions, including autism, cerebral palsy, Down syndrome, Rett syndrome, and other rare genetic disorders. Sarah is deeply committed to the field of pediatric occupational therapy and is passionate about supporting children and their families in achieving their goals.
Her therapeutic approach is grounded in creativity and individualized care. She strives to make sessions engaging, purposeful, and tailored to each child’s unique strengths and needs.
Outside of work, Sarah enjoys staying active and spending time outdoors. Her hobbies include running, strength training, biking, hiking, skiing, and Pilates.

Occupational Therapist
Kim Giesbrecht
BScOT
Kim recently relocated to the Kootenay region from Edmonton, Alberta, bringing with her over 20 years of experience in pediatric occupational therapy. She has worked in diverse settings including schools, hospitals, and community-based programs, and is
deeply passionate about supporting children and their families. Throughout her career, Kim has provided comprehensive OT services for children with a wide range of complex needs. She also has
extensive experience in pediatric hand therapy and splinting for both acute injuries and congenital differences in hand development. Kim has a special interest in the area of feeding, including picky eating and feeding difficulties. She integrates her developmental expertise with a neurodiversity-affirming approach to offer families supportive and practical strategies that promote positive and
enjoyable mealtimes. At the heart of Kim’s practice is her commitment to helping children and their families build the skills and confidence they need to thrive in the activities and routines that
matter most to them. Outside of work, Kim enjoys mountain biking, hiking, skiing, reading, and spending quality time with her family.
